The Company
Our client are a multi disciplinary consultancy with over 6 offices in the UK. Their projects span a range of sectors and their services include architecture, building surveying, building services engineering, planning, interior design, sustainability, civil and structural engineering, quantity surveying, project management, CDM and health and safety services.
The Opportunity
The BIM Manager role is a new role for the practice, pulling together a number of areas of their business with the objective of helping the practice achieve ISO 19650 compliance at a high level but aiding in gaining greater efficiency, standardization of drawing procedures, components, and data infrastructure for the benefit of the practice fee earning teams. The BIM Manager role will be at the focus of a number of activity streams focused around quality but will also play a part in project delivery on key BIM level 2 projects in helping to ensure projects are correctly set up and the process of delivery of BIM level 2 projects is managed.
